Publicis Sapient is a digital transformation partner helping established organizations get to their future, digitally enabled state, both in the way they work and the way they serve their customers. We help unlock value through a start‑up mindset and modern methods, fusing strategy, consulting, and customer experience with agile engineering and problem‑solving creativity. United by our core values and our purpose of helping people thrive in the brave pursuit of next, our 20,000+ people in 53 offices around the world combine experience across technology, data sciences, consulting, and customer obsession to accelerate our clients’ businesses through designing the products and services their customers truly value.

In this exciting, challenging and rewarding Senior Associate, People Strategy (HR Advisor) position, you will play a key role in enabling our people to thrive. Reporting to a member of our People Strategy team (Senior HR Business Partner) and partnering closely with two team members doing the same role and other HR Business Partners to support different capabilities and industries within the business. You will be the first point of contact for your client groups and provide people operations to drive great people experiences and business impact.

The ideal candidate will be dynamic, structured thinking, a fast learner, have strong inter‑personal skills, and be passionate about delivering fantastic operations for our people.

Responsibilities
  • Performance management – Support in Talent reviews and handling of individual performance cases.
  • People Growth – Support all phases of our growth philosophy, including goal/OKR setting, feedback, fluid promotions, and annual impact discussions.
  • Total rewards – Partner with the people strategists and Compensation team on annual merit increases, bonus payouts, and off cycles.
  • Engagement and culture – Roll out of programs and activities including Core Value awards, recognition drives, DE&I work, surveys, pulse checks, mentoring, driving hybrid working and mentoring.
  • Managing and supporting employee relations cases – this could involve redundancies, restructures, grievances etc.
  • Participating in special project taskforces for new initiatives.
  • Leveraging and analyzing Data to understand focus areas for capabilities and industries.
  • Project managing, operations management, and administrative support of talent programs. This will include note taking, planning, status tracking, and issue/risk management.
  • Synthesis and analysis of data to drive insights and support data driven people decisions.
  • Driving change, through effective communication and roll‑out of talent initiatives to leadership, People Managers, and employees.
  • Being the voice, and ears, on the ground.
  • Advising people managers and employees on policies and processes.
  • Partnering closely with People Strategy operations colleagues across the region, and globally in India and the Americas to enable better practice, synergies, and local activation of global programs.
  • Partnering closely with HR lifecycle colleagues and other teams (global mobility, staffing, learning and development) on employee cases, ensuring legal compliance, and updating our HRIS and paperwork.
Qualifications Experience Guidelines:
  • A background in Human Resources Operations.
  • Has experience of employee lifecycle, supporting employee relations, redundancies etc.
  • A passion for enhancing our people’s experience throughout their lifecycle and driving business impact.
  • An eye for detail and ability to run processes independently.
  • A track record in pro‑actively identifying opportunities for improvements and driving change.
  • An ability to work in a complex matrix structured, ambiguous, constantly changing business situation.
  • Strong analytical skills and ability to convert data into insights and solutions, strong excel expertise.
  • An interest in using AI to create smarter working.
  • Strong interpersonal skills including the ability to form relationships at all levels.
  • Worked in a global environment (preferable).
  • Bachelor’s degree preferred.
  • CIPD preferred.
